# Muscles Part 2
## muscle tension
* isotonic, movement
* concentric - shorten
* eccentric - lengthen
* isometric, no movement

## Muscles (almost) never work alone
* aiding, opposite work together
prime mover/ agonist -> main muscle moving things
synergist -> assits movement
antagonist -> opposite movement of agonist
* maintains body position
* needed for rapid movement
